At AltimateMedical, we design and manufacture innovative medical equipment that supports people living with disabilities in the complex rehabilitation space. Our products help individuals stand taller, move better, and live more independently. And we're growing!
We operate by three commitments:
Build Trust. Deliver Results with Passion. Invest for Good. These are not slogans-they guide how we design products, partner with customers, and develop our people. We are seeking a NetSuite Support Specialist to support and strengthen business operations across AltimateMedical and its family of brands. This role ensures effective use of NetSuite and related applications while serving as a key connection between users and systems. This is a hybrid-role requiring the ability to commute to the Morton/Redwood Falls location twice per month. The position reports to the Director of Technology and provides day-to-day support, promotes data integrity, and helps improve workflows across manufacturing, inventory, and cross-functional teams. Over time, the role will grow into deeper involvement with system optimization, training, documentation, and continuous improvement initiatives.
